  5. Fort Stewart Hostages: Ex-Army Soldier Threatens 3 Hospital Workers
    SAVANNAH, Ga. — A former Army soldier seeking help for mental problems at a Georgia military hospital took three workers hostage at gunpoint Monday before authorities persuaded him to surrender. No one was hurt and no shots were fired in the short standoff at Winn Army Community Hospital on Fort Stewart, about 40 miles southwest of Savannah, said fort spokesman Kevin Larson.
